ISLAMABAD: United States (US) Ambassador to Pakistan Donald Blome on Friday held a meeting with Abdul Aleem Khan, Federal Minister for Investment Board, Communications, and Privatization, to explore investment opportunities in the country.

The meeting underscored mutual interest in bolstering economic ties and attracting American businesses to Pakistan. Minister Abdul Aleem Khan acknowledged Pakistan’s economic challenges but highlighted significant investment prospects.

He assured Ambassador Bloom of the government’s commitment to facilitate potential investments, citing the crucial role of Pakistani diaspora in bolstering foreign exchange reserves.

Khan expressed a focus on enhancing infrastructure, particularly highways and motorways, to boost connectivity and support economic development.

Both sides expressed optimism and a shared commitment to strengthening bilateral economic relations.
